Small Animal Urgent Care Medicine Clinician
The Department of Clinical Sciences and the Veterinary Health Center, College of Veterinary Medicine at Kansas State University invites applications for a clinical, 1-year, renewable appointment as a Small Animal Urgent Care Clinician (SAUCC). Candidates must hold a DVM degree or equivalent. Preference will be given to candidates who have completed internship training or have three years of experience in small animal practice. The SAUCC will serve as a faculty member within the Pet Health and Nutrition Center and also work closely with the Surgery and Internal Medicine specialty services within the Veterinary Health Center.
